Output d40a1e01d4fe6acebf93323174ce1e68465ee956e069241844bf314905d89055:8

value
7932798
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b659e5778e07348a94f579d1805aad638349b775 OP_EQUAL
address
3JKCbZjVeGvFm4zPPnzFiDE8M8Rcqjf1eH
transaction
d40a1e01d4fe6acebf93323174ce1e68465ee956e069241844bf314905d89055
confirmations
308604
spent
true